vm.save(vote); int id=vote.getId(); 批量時,傳入list,獲取時類同單個,mybatis自動把自增的id裝入list中的對象的id,mapper.xml寫法如: 另:上述方式確實不能返回自增id,而且還報 ...
首先mybatis版本必需是 . . 或以上 mapper配置文件中 注意部分: Mapper接口方法 DAO實現 參考鏈接 https: blog.csdn.net top code article details https: blog.csdn.net u article details ...
2019-04-18 20:59 0 792 推薦指數:
vm.save(vote); int id=vote.getId(); 批量時,傳入list,獲取時類同單個,mybatis自動把自增的id裝入list中的對象的id,mapper.xml寫法如: 另:上述方式確實不能返回自增id,而且還報 ...
;。 但是怎么對批量插入數據返回自增主鍵的解決方式網上看到的還是比較少,至少百度的結果比較少。 Mybatis官網資 ...
目錄 背景 底層調用方法 單個對象插入 直接保存實體的對象作為參數傳入(給偽代碼示例) 多個對象,實體對象作為其中一個對象傳入 列表批量插入 直接保存實體的對象作為參數傳入(給偽代碼示例) 多個對象,實體 ...
在myBatis中獲取剛剛插入的數據的主鍵id是比較容易的 , 一般來說下面的一句話就可以搞定了 , 網上也有很多相關資料去查. @Options(useGeneratedKeys = true, keyProperty = "money_record_id") 但是相比較 ...
由於項目需要生成多條數據,並保存到數據庫當中,在程序中封裝了一個List集合對象,然后需要把該集合中的實體插入到數據庫中,項目使用了Spring+MyBatis,所以打算使用MyBatis批量插入,應該要比循環插入的效果更好,由於之前沒用過批量插入,在網上找了一些資料后最終實現了,把詳細過程 ...
由於項目需要生成多條數據,並保存到數據庫當中,在程序中封裝了一個List集合對象,然后需要把該集合中的實體插入到數據庫中,項目使用了Spring+MyBatis,所以打算使用MyBatis批量插入,應該要比循環插入的效果更好,由於之前沒用過批量插入,在網上找了一些資料后最終實現了,把詳細 ...
Mybatis在插入單條數據的時候有兩種方式返回自增主鍵: mybatis3.3.1支持批量插入后返回主鍵ID, 首先對於支持自增主鍵的數據庫:useGenerateKeys和keyProperty。 不支持生成自增主鍵的數據庫:<selectKey>。 這里主要說下批量 ...
From: https://www.cnblogs.com/xiao-lei/p/6809884.html Mybatis在插入單條數據的時候有兩種方式返回自增主鍵: mybatis3.3.1支持批量插入后返回主鍵ID, 首先對於支持自增主鍵的數據 ...